Preparing Your Hair for the Ponytail

Preparing Your Hair For The Ponytail, Musics

Before you even think about elastics and hairspray, you need to prep your hair. This is crucial for achieving the volume and hold needed for a concert-worthy ponytail. Start with clean, dry hair. If your hair is naturally oily, use a clarifying shampoo to remove any buildup that could weigh it down. Consider using a volumizing mousse or spray before blow-drying. Think of it like priming a canvas before painting – it creates a smooth, even surface for the real magic to happen. Don’t skip this step; it’s the secret weapon for a long-lasting, voluminous ponytail.

The Perfect Blowout

The Perfect Blowout, Musics

A bouncy, voluminous blowout is essential for achieving Ariana’s signature look. Flip your head upside down while blow-drying to maximize volume at the roots. Use a round brush to smooth out the hair and create a slight curl at the ends. This will give your ponytail a more polished and refined appearance. Remember, we’re aiming for a look that’s both effortless and glamorous, so don’t be afraid to experiment with different techniques to find what works best for your hair type. This is like practicing scales before a big performance – you’re getting your hair ready to shine!

Creating the Foundation

Creating The Foundation, Musics

Now for the tricky part: creating that sleek, secure base that will hold your ponytail in place all night long. Start by parting your hair where you want the ponytail to sit – usually high on the crown of your head. Use a fine-tooth comb and a strong-hold gel or hairspray to smooth down any flyaways and create a super-sleek finish. Think of this as creating a canvas – it needs to be smooth and even to allow the rest of the artwork to truly shine. The smoother the base, the more dramatic the ponytail will appear.

Securing the Ponytail

Securing The Ponytail, Musics

Choosing the right elastic is crucial for a secure and comfortable ponytail. Opt for a thick, sturdy elastic that can hold your hair in place without causing breakage. Gather your hair into a high ponytail and secure it with the elastic. For extra security, you can use two elastics or even bobby pins to reinforce the base. Imagine building a bridge – you need strong supports to prevent it from collapsing under pressure. The same principle applies to your ponytail! A little extra support will ensure it stays put, no matter how hard you dance.

Wrapping the Base

Wrapping The Base, Musics

One of the key elements of Ariana’s polished ponytail is that you never see the elastic. To achieve this, take a small section of hair from underneath the ponytail and wrap it around the base of the elastic. Secure the end of the section with a bobby pin. This creates a seamless, elegant finish that elevates the entire look. This is like adding the finishing touches to a painting – it’s the little details that make all the difference. That wrapped section creates that flawless, high-end vibe that separates a normal pony from the Ariana Grande special.

Perfecting the Ponytail

Perfecting The Ponytail, Musics

Now that you have the basic structure of your ponytail, it’s time to add some final touches. Use a teasing comb to gently tease the hair at the crown of your head for extra volume. This will create a more dramatic and flattering silhouette. You can also use a curling iron or wand to add some waves or curls to the ponytail for added texture and dimension. Finally, finish with a shine spray to enhance the hair’s natural luster and create a healthy, radiant glow. Just like a sculptor adding the final details to a statue, these steps bring out the best in your ponytail.

Hairspray is Your Best Friend

Hairspray Is Your Best Friend, Musics

Let’s be honest, a concert-worthy ponytail needs some serious staying power. Hairspray is your best friend when it comes to locking everything in place. Use a strong-hold hairspray to mist your entire ponytail, focusing on the roots and the ends. This will prevent flyaways and ensure that your ponytail stays put, no matter how much you sweat or dance. Pro tip: hold the hairspray can at least 12 inches away from your head to avoid creating a sticky, crunchy texture. This is like applying a sealant to a finished project – it protects your hard work and ensures it lasts.

Post-Concert Care

Post-Concert Care, Musics

After a night of singing and dancing, it’s important to remove your ponytail carefully to avoid damaging your hair. Gently remove the elastic and any bobby pins. If you used hairspray, use a clarifying shampoo to remove any residue. Follow up with a deep conditioning treatment to replenish moisture and restore your hair’s natural shine. Remember, your hair has been through a lot, so it deserves a little extra TLC. This is like giving your body a rest after a strenuous workout – it’s essential for recovery and long-term health.

How do I keep my ponytail from drooping throughout the night?

How Do I Keep My Ponytail From Drooping Throughout The Night?, Musics

Drooping is a common ponytail problem! The key is a solid foundation. Make sure your base is smooth and secure. Use a strong-hold hairspray before and after creating the ponytail. Bobby pins can also be your secret weapon – strategically place them around the base of the ponytail to provide extra support. And don’t be afraid to give your hair a quick tease at the roots for extra volume and lift before you put it up!

What's the best way to hide the elastic in my ponytail?

What's The Best Way To Hide The Elastic In My Ponytail?, Musics

Hiding the elastic is essential for a polished, high-end look. Take a small section of hair from underneath the ponytail and wrap it around the base of the elastic, completely concealing it. Secure the end of the section with a bobby pin, making sure it’s hidden underneath the wrapped hair. For extra security, you can use a clear elastic instead of a colored one. With a little practice, you’ll be able to create a seamless, flawless finish every time!
